Transfer through USB-cable: classics with nuances

The most reliable and fastest way is to connect your phone to your PC via cable, with transfer speeds of 40-60 MB/s (for USB 2.0) and up to 400 MB/s (USB 3.0), but there are pitfalls from MIUI settings to drivers on your computer.

To transfer files:

  • πŸ”Œ Connect Xiaomi to your PC with the original cable (cheap analogues may not support data transfer).
  • πŸ“± The phone will be notified "Charge through" USB" β€” tap him.
  • πŸ”„ Select the "File Transfer" mode" (MTP) or β€œTransmission of photographs" (PTP) (last-hand RAW-photo).
  • πŸ–₯️ On your computer, open "This Computer" - the phone will appear as a removable disk.

Critical detail: on Xiaomi with HyperOS (2026), MTP mode can automatically shut down after 5 minutes of inactivity - watch for notification on your phone.

Bluetooth 4: Slowly but without internet

Bluetooth is suitable for transferring small files (up to 50 MB) when there are no other options, speed is only 1-3 MB / s, but you do not need Wi-Fi or cable.

How to send a file over Bluetooth:

  • πŸ“± On the phone: open the file β†’ "Share" β†’ Bluetooth β†’ Choose a computer.
  • πŸ–₯️ On PC: Enable Bluetooth in "Settings" β†’ Devices" and confirm the file's acceptance.

⚠️ Note: On Windows 11, Bluetooth can freeze when transferring large files. If the process stops, restart the Bluetooth service: press Win + R, enter services.msc, find Bluetooth Support Service and restart it.

5. Transfer through OTG-wire-drive

If you need to transfer files to your computer, but not at hand USB-Xiaomi cables, you can use them OTG-adapter and a simple flash drive, which is universal, but requires additional accessories.

Step-by-step:

  1. Connect. OTG-Adapter to the phone, and to it – flash drive (preferably exFAT or NTFS file-wise >4GB).
  2. In the file manager MIUI (Files), find the necessary data and copy it to the flash drive.
  3. Remove the flash drive and connect it to the computer.

πŸ”Ή How to transfer files >4 GB if the flash drive is in FAT32?
Options: Format the flash drive to exFAT or NTFS (Warning: data will be deleted!). Break the file into pieces with an archiver (for example, 7-Zip with the option "Separate into volumes"). Use the cloud (Google Drive or Mega support large files).
